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ting from the heart of the East End, head towards the Eastern Promenade. You can do this by walking east on any of the main streets like Congress Street or Washington Avenue. Once you reach the Eastern Promenade, turn south (right) and continue walking along the waterfront. The Major Charles Loring Memorial Park is located at 449-455 Eastern Promenade, which is a short walk from the waterfront path.

  • Bicycle

    For those who prefer biking, rent a bike from a local rental shop in East End. Head towards the Eastern Promenade, and once you reach the waterfront, follow the path south along the promenade. The park is easily accessible by bike, and you will find bike racks available near the park entrance.

  • Public Transit (Bus)

    If you are near a bus stop, you can take the METRO bus service. Look for routes that head towards the Eastern Promenade. You may need to transfer at a central hub, such as the Portland Transportation Center. Make sure to check the schedule on the METRO website or app for the latest updates. Fares are typically around $2.00 for a single ride.

Discover more about Major Charles Loring Memorial Park

Major Charles Loring Memorial Park is a captivating blend of nature, history, and community spirit located in Portland, Maine's picturesque East End. This memorial park not only serves as a tribute to Major Charles Loring, a notable figure in Portland's history, but also stands as a serene spot for visitors and locals alike to unwind and enjoy the beauty of the surrounding landscape. With its expansive green spaces, shaded walking paths, and stunning views of Casco Bay, the park is an ideal location for leisurely strolls, family picnics, or simply soaking in the peaceful atmosphere.
